thikolam tōk tsizōn (paint them yellow)An English equivilant would be "give it horns"
Usage:
za kjatsanpa! thikolam tōk thelāvē tsizōn! (Come on boys! Paint these idiots yellow!)
mekszo to ksē epfjom/epflom (jump on the epfjom)
To give up, but in a positive way.
Usage:
hōkrēlō to thōsta mekszola knor to ksē epfjom a ha govigape rakjita a. (I think we should just jump on the epfjom and get some beers)
